Hi,

I'm looking for anime with surrealistic or abstract imagery. So far I've got Bakemonogatari, Puella Magi Madoka Magica, Summer Wars, The Girl Who Leapt through time, Arakawa under the Bridge, and any of the Genius Party/Genius Party Beyond minis. Just wondering if anyone had any other good suggestions, doesn't have to be predeominant in the series if there are just a few good abstract/surreal clips it would help me out, thanks. :)
